Pencoed station is modest, focusing primarily on the essentials required for rail travel. It's important for visitors to note that there is no ticket office or machine available, meaning tickets must be purchased online prior to arrival. While lacking in ticket facilities, it does have smartcard validators, making travel seamless for those equipped with this technology.
Accessibility is thoughtfully considered with step-free access towards the platforms via Hendre Road, although it's useful to remember that crossing platforms may require the use of a footbridge with steps. Furthermore, for those needing additional assistance, Transport for Wales offers a helpline to answer travel queries and help plan your journey with confidence.
Pencoed station may not offer formal luggage storage or customer help points, but its village charm and location near essential bus routes make it straightforward for travelers to find their way onwards. Local bus stops are conveniently located on Penybont Road, offering routes towards Cardiff and Bridgend, ensuring seamless links for adventure or business beyond the station itself.

Despite its smaller stature, Pencoed station caters well to those prepared for their journey ahead. With no dining facilities, shopping outlets, or ATMs on site, planning in advance for such needs in the nearby town is advisable. However, the Park and Ride operated by Bridgend County Borough Council provides a useful spot for local parking, boasting 56 spaces at no cost, ensuring convenience and affordability.

While Hillington East station may not boast an array of luxurious amenities, it offers the essential services needed for a smooth journey. The ticket office is operational from Monday to Saturday between 07:10 and 14:14, where you can collect tickets you've bought online. However, it's worth noting that this station does not offer ticket machines or smartcard issuance, though there are smartcard validators available for ease of travel.
The station offers partial step-free access, making it relatively accommodating for travelers with mobility challenges. Platform access varies, with a ramp to platform 1 and level access to platform 2, connected by a footbridge. Keep in mind the stepping distance when boarding trains might be a bit more challenging here. Unfortunately, amenities such as public Wi-Fi, refreshments, and restrooms are not available, which is something to consider when planning your visit.
Should you need to continue your journey by bus or taxi, Hillington East offers several convenient transportation links. Bus services pick up from Carnegie Road, and for more details on schedules, you can visit Traveline Scotland or dial their hotline. Although taxis are not directly available at the station, you can find operator details on TrainTaxi to plan your pick-up.
